This historical fiction captures the adventures of David Balfour, a young boy who was kidnapped by his own uncle. Set around 18th century Scottish events, it narrates how David was kidnapped and cast away, his sufferings in a desert island, his journey in the wild highlands, his dealing with the notorious highland Jacobites, and finally how he received his inheritance. Also, it vividly portrays the political situation of the time in Scotland.

Robert Louis Stevenson, a well-known Scottish author, was born to Thomas Stevenson and Margaret on November 13, 1850 at Edinburgh, Scotland. His major writings include Treasure Island, An Inland Voyage, Kidnapped, The Silverado Squatters, The Beach of Falesa, The Ebb-Tide, Vailima Letters, A Child’s Garden of Verses, and Underwoods. He died on December 3, 1894 at the age of forty-four.
